What You’ll Do
As a BCBA or BCaBA on our team, you’ll play a vital role in delivering compassionate, evidence-based behavioral health services. Your responsibilities will include:
Conducting assessments and diagnostic evaluations for children with autism and developmental disabilities
Developing and implementing individualized behavior intervention and treatment plans
Providing one-on-one therapy and family support
Supervising and mentoring BTs/RBTs to ensure consistent, high-quality care
Collaborating with interdisciplinary teams to create well-rounded care solutions
Maintaining accurate and confidential documentation (HIPAA-compliant)
Staying informed on current research and best practices in behavioral health
What You Bring
We’re looking for team members who are not only qualified but genuinely care.
BCBA or BCaBA Certification
Master’s Degree in Applied Behavior Analysis or a related field
Experience working with children and individuals with autism or developmental disabilities
Strong clinical and interpersonal communication skills
Empathy, patience, and a commitment to client-centered care
Reliable transportation
Active CPR Certification (we'll help you get certified if needed)
Ability to pass a background check (required by funding sources)
Willingness and physical ability to work directly with children (lift up to 50 lbs, kneel, sit on the floor, etc.)
